Understanding Pfas Contamination

PFAS, or perfluoroalkyl and polyfluoroalkyl substances, are a group of man-made chemicals that have garnered attention due to their potential adverse health effects and environmental persistence. PFAS contamination occurs when these substances leach into the environment from various sources, such as industrial activities, firefighting foams, and consumer products. Once released, PFAS can accumulate in soil, water, and air, posing a risk to human health and wildlife.

These chemicals have been linked to a range of health issues, including reproductive and developmental problems, liver and kidney damage, and an increased risk of certain cancers. The concern about PFAS contamination has prompted regulatory agencies and public health organizations to monitor and regulate the use and disposal of these substances. Individuals can be exposed to PFAS through contaminated drinking water, food packaging, and household products, highlighting the need for increased awareness and preventive measures.
